Output 5ae013c83e439a1db3469e06b007baded43a94b39988d76b542abfe5401a23f0:0

value
29404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 879a4ddddf39243696c42eb5a13a1a46729e3882 OP_EQUAL
address
3E41zgXat2oPRPUmKPV74zQ8MniKfcNmri
transaction
5ae013c83e439a1db3469e06b007baded43a94b39988d76b542abfe5401a23f0
confirmations
136586
spent
true